Netbios / windows sharing er desværre ikke lige sådan at dele - idet broadcasts kun meget sjældent hopper over en gateway .. så der skal du have sat noget WINS op for at få det til at spille - og det betyder nok desværre en Windows NT som server.
Halflife kender jeg desværre ikke noget til. Formentligt kræver det en dobbeltrettet forbindelse, så måske du skal bruge "redir" el. lign.
Det er bare en portmapper til linux .. som sagt, kender ikke halflife, så jeg har ingen anelse om den ville kunne gøre noget godt. :-(
Har du nogen mulighed for at beskrive hvilke porte etc HalfLife kræver? Hvis ja, skulle det ikke være så svært at beskrive en fremgangsmåde - men umiddelbart burde det virke som du har gjort ovenfor (i hvert tilfælde så længe du ikke ønsker at være server).
Jeg formoder at du bruger LINUX kassen som router til internettet. Eller ? Hvis du gør skal du have LINUX kassen sat som default gateway på begge subnet. Hvad er du vil med Halflife ? Er det maskinerne på dine to net der skal kunne se hinanden ? Prøv at beskive dit net mere indgående. Hvordan kobler du op til Internettet ? Har du en router der hedder 172.16.1.1 på det ene net ? Hvis du har og det er din udgang til internettet skal du for at kunne få 'pakker' tilbage til 192.168.0.0 nettet lave en rute på 172.16.1.1 som fortæller hvilken IPadresse der kan skabe forbindelse til 192.168.0.0 nettet. Håber du fik lidt at tygge i.
Nu tror jeg at jeg har dit net: www -- 172.. -- linux -- 192.. M$
Hvis det er korrekt er det ikke nødvendigt for dig at MASQ'e mellem de to net. Aktiver IP_FORWARD på din LINUX box og drop alle firewall regler.
Din router laver allerede 'MASQ' 'NAT' til Internettet så det problem er der taget hånd om.
For at pakker kan komme fra 192... til Internettet og tilbage igen skal din router kende vejen. Så du bliver nødt til at add'e en route tilbage fra den til dit 192... net.
MASQurade er ikke helt det samme som routing. MASQ er en metode til at omdanne 'private' IPadresser til Offentlige IPadresser og tilbage igen. Dette gør man fordi det ikke er muligt at route private IPadresser på internettet.
Der er ikke nogen grund til at køre rip når du kun behøver en statisk rute på routeren som peger på linux kassen som gw til 192... nettet og hvis du sætter linux kassen til at have routeren som GW og maskinerne i 192... nettet til at have linux kassen som gw så spiller det. Hvis du vil bruge rip skal både linux kassen og routeren 'rippe'.
OK, almindelig høflighed: Skriv selv løsningen på dit svar op, og accepter så dette.
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.